Report Title: In Vivo Rat Micronucleus Assay
Author(s): Gregory L. Erexson, Ph.D
Contractor: Covance Laboratories, Inc., Vienna, Virginia
Study Dates: Initiation: October 18, 2001 In Life: October 23, 2001 - November 19, 2001 Completion: January 25, 2002
Study Objective: To evaluate 8-2 Alcohol for in vivo clastogenic activity and/or disruption of the mitotic apparatus by examining bone marrow polychromatic erythrocytes in male CRL:CD(SD)IGS BR rats for micronuclei.
Materials and Methods: Groups of male rats (5/group) were administered a single oral gavage dose of either 0 (vehicle 0.5% aqueous methyl cellulose), 500, 1000, or 2000 mg 8-2 Alcohol/kg body weight. A positive control group of rats received a single oral dose of 60 mg cyclophosphamide/kg. At both 24 and 48 hours, 5 rats from each group were sacrificed and bone marrow was extracted from the tibia. Slides were prepared and scored for micronuclei and the PCE/NCE (polychromatic erythrocytes) (normochromatic erythrocytes) cell ratio was counted (scored at least the first 500 erythrocytes on each slide). Assay acceptance criteria was met with the criteria for a positive response being the detection of a statistically significant increase in micronucleated PCE's for at least 1 dose level and a statistically significant dose-related response.
Findings: No lethality or signs of clinical toxicity were seen in the rats given in either 500, 1000, or 2000 mg/kg. 8-2 Alcohol did not induce a statistically significant increase in micronucleated PCE's at any of the dose levels tested. The positive control material showed the expected response demonstrating the sensitivity of the test system.

Conclusion: 8-2 Alcohol is considered negative in the rat bone marrow micronucleus assay under the conditions of this assay.
